The 03906 ZIP Code is centered1 in York County at latitude 43.306 and longitude -70.743. It is a standard type ZIP Code. York County is in the Eastern Time Zone (UTC -5 hours) and observes daylight savings time.

The population in ZIP Code Tabulation Area (ZCTA) 03906 was 4,329 with 1,728 housing units; a land area land area of 38.62 sq. miles; a water area of 0 sq. miles; and a population density of 112.10 people per sq. mile for Census 2000. Demographic Profile
